We went to Hephaestus’s temple. The temple is the only one that is still in really good shape.
Who is Hephaestus? Hephaestus is the god of fire, metalworking, stone masonry, forges and the art of sculpture and volcanoes. He is the son of Zeus ,god of skies and Hera ,goddess of marriage. Hephaestus’s symbols are hammers, anvils , tongs, and quails. He is married to Aphrodite and his children are Thalia, Eucleia, Eupheme, Philophrosyne, Cabeiri and Euthenia.
